The Enlisted Masquerade - Mardi Gras 2008 event will kick off the summer with a night of dancing, food and fun for enlisted members June 7 at the Vance Collocated Club, and plans for the evening festivities are in full swing. 

In February, Airman 1st Class Bethany Lawton, 71st Force Support Squadron assignments technician, wanted to create an event for people to socialize and have fun. 

"There aren't too many opportunities for people to dress up in civilian attire and enjoy themselves," said the airman from Jacksonville, Fla. "I had the idea for a social gathering that would provide a relaxed, formal and fun environment for everyone - from under-age dormitory residents to chief master sergeants. Our hope is to bring together enlisted Airman from across the base to socialize and foster camaraderie." 

Dress for the affair is dinner casual attire, and the affair features music, dancing, games and door prizes. There will also be a competition for best dressed male, female and couple. The guest speaker for the evening is Chief Master Sgt. Tim Rogers, 71st Security Forces Squadron superintendent. 

Vance Airmen are stepping up and doing great things for the base, said 71st Flying Training Wing Command Chief Master Sgt. Ruben Gonzalez.

"Our Airmen have taken the lead on putting together on an event to enhance Vance's enlisted corps. It will be a great opportunity to get to know other Airmen on base along with having the opportunity to hear some motivating words from Chief Master Sgt. Tim Rogers." 

Planning is ongoing and fund raising is an important part of the event's success. So far, committee members raised more than $800 and continue their efforts.
